Cabbage and Sina Thorns

Thorns are basically hard structures which the plant posses in order to deter animals from eating plant material. They are also called as spines. Not all the plants have thorns; some plants have thorns and some don’t. Thus Cabbage and Sina Thorns is an important aspect. Cabbage does not have thorns and Sina does not have thorns.
